Commercial Description:
This beer is our regular Bender beer with a cold-press coffee-brewing process. We steep 20 gallons at a time, so this beer will pop up at Tours, beer fests and special tappings. The coffee is roasted locally at Coffee & Tea Limited in Linden Hills.

Poured a translucent brown color with a small, light tan head that left nice lacing on the glass. Aroma of roasted malts, caramel, coffee, pine, toast, and some floral hops. Taste of caramel malts, some roasted coffee beans, vanilla, and tobacco, with a dry finish.

Can shared by hopdog. Pours a deeper brown with lots of ruby notes coming through and a medium creamy off white head that laced. Aroma of coffee (duh), vanilla, some hops peaking through, caramel, nuts and toasted malt. Flavor of coffee, toasted malt, nuts, tobacco and light hops.

Pint can via trade with Scoobydank. Pours a cloudy deep chestnut brown with a small cream white lacing head. Nose is of coffee, nuts, and malt. Nice mild coffee flavors, a strong nut flavor as well. Mouth is medium bodied and a little sticky. Very flavorful 5% beer! Reminds me a bit of the Nestea instant mix Grandma use to make, yum!
